Job Description

Pharmacy Technician

Location: Portland, ME – 100% onsite

Schedule: Monday–Friday, 8:00 AM–4:30 PM or 8:30 AM–5:00 PM

Pay: $19.22–$24.88/hour

Type: Temporary assignment

Interview Process: Onsite interview with hiring team

Requirements: Active Maine Pharmacy Technician License or ability to obtain before start (2-day process, $62 fee, candidate responsibility)

Background Check: Required

We’re seeking a reliable, detail-oriented Pharmacy Technician for a back-office role with minimal patient interaction. This position is ideal for someone who thrives in a structured, process-driven environment. No prior pharmacy experience is required—training is provided for the right candidate with the willingness to learn and grow.

Key Responsibilities

  • Maintain accurate patient profiles, including demographics, insurance, and allergies
  • Enter prescription orders with precision and ensure timely fulfillment
  • Answer patient inquiries about pricing, product availability, and coverage; escalate clinical questions to pharmacists as needed
  • Support various pharmacy functions, including data entry, filling, shipping, inventory, and call center tasks
  • Handle sensitive information with discretion and maintain regulatory compliance
  • Communicate with internal medical staff regarding refills and non-clinical medication questions
  • Assist with purchasing to help reduce costs for patients and the organization

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Active Maine Pharmacy Technician License (or ability to obtain prior to start)
  • Strong computer skills and attention to detail
  • Excellent communication and problem-solving abilities
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, high-volume environment
  • Previous pharmacy or medical experience preferred, but not required

This is a great opportunity to step into the healthcare field, gain hands-on pharmacy operations experience, and work with a supportive team.
